I Headcanon that...
Exos are weird.
But that's a good thing... in some ways.
There are multiple models of exo and multiple types. The leading name in exo science was obviously Clovis Bray, but few others pop up later on once exo science is perfected.
Now you exo lovers may hate me on this but, exos are not a human conversion. Exos have no biological parts they are fully autonomous robots. "But Attack." I hear you say. "Cayde mentioned in his journals he remembered his life before." He has flashes of memories that he doesn't remember of people he doesn't exist.
His mind is a fake one. And the thing about humans... is that we without memory yearn for them. We know we have forgotten or that there should be there. Fake memories? Implanted into war machines so they can live? So they can think. A machine who can think and react is a better soldier. The issue with giving them humanlike-minds, they need human like memories.
That's where DER comes in. To implant these memories they have to boot you up. And sometimes a brain doesn't like fake memories and rejects them. Either their too good, or not good enough or not cohesive. Making a human is hard. I'm certain there are a lot of exos who were never human. Just close approximations of them. Given lives that never existed.
Now some are due to life altering events, a rich man's daughter is sick or dying? Make her into a robot. Right? You can just make them into a robot? An old man fears death so he becomes an exo. That's how it works you just become robot... wait how does flesh become robot?
It doesn't.
Any human "saved" by the Exo science lab died. Dead and gone. If Clovis Bray and other such labs can make a fake human life and implant them into a robot. What's to say they can't forge the memories of a living person, learning just enough to make cohesive minds to implant into a body. I mean, its not hard to tell someone. "Your name is Henry Sterling. You are an exo now." All the while the real Henry is rotting away ... actually probably burned. The lapse in memory? DER. Changes to personality? DER. Its the catch all ain't it?.
Exos are weird. Exos are Warmachines. Make a new character in D1 it tells you as such.
War takes many forms.
Surveillance.
Reconnaissance.
Infiltration.
Destruction.
There are some exo types that have features to help them fight. Auto targeting systems, vocal replication and mimicry. Internal weapon systems. Armour plates. Who knows what makes and models they have.
But exos have human minds. And arguably human souls. But odd how the traveler. Won't rezz a fallen or cabal to protect itself but it will a war machine with no biological components.
